Electrician Certificate, Diploma and Degree Options<\/strong><\/h3>\n

\"SealyThere are three general ways to get electrician instruction in a vocational or trade school near Sealy TX. You can select a certificate or diploma program, or receive an Associate Degree. Bachelor’s Degrees are obtainable at some schools, but are not as prevalent as the first three alternatives. Often these programs are made available together with an apprenticeship program, which are mandated by most states to become licensed or if you wish to earn certification.
